Appeal Filed Against 10-Year Prison Sentence for Gangdong District Office Official Embezzling 11.5 Billion Won

[Asia Economy Reporter Jang Sehee] The prosecution has appealed the first trial verdict of Kim Mo (47), a Grade 7 public official at Gangdong District Office in Seoul, who is accused of embezzling 11.5 billion KRW of public funds.


According to the legal community on the 16th, the prosecution filed an appeal yesterday with the 12th Criminal Division of the Seoul Eastern District Court, the first trial court handling Kim’s case, who was indicted on charges of violating the Act on the Aggravated Punishment of Specific Economic Crimes (embezzlement) and forgery of official documents. On the 9th, the first trial court sentenced Kim to 10 years in prison and also ordered the confiscation of approximately 7.6 billion KRW.


Kim is accused of embezzling the entire 11.5 billion KRW in waste disposal facility installation contributions paid by Seoul Housing & Communities Corporation (SH) to Gangdong District Office from December 2019 to February last year, and using the funds for stock investments and personal debt repayment. Kim also allegedly falsified internal settlement and performance reports at the district office to conceal the embezzlement.


Kim has returned 3.8 billion KRW of the embezzled 11.5 billion KRW, and it has been confirmed that most of the remaining 7.7 billion KRW was lost through stock investments.
